Locus Comment: Contact: Patrick Schweizer; Transcriptome Analysis, Cytogenetics Department; Institute of Plant Genetics and Crop Plant Research (IPK); Corrensstr. 3, D-06466 Gatersleben, Germany; Tel: 0049 (0)39482-5660; Fax: 0049 (0)39482-5595; Email: schweiz@ipk-gatersleben.de; Insert Length: 668 Std Error: 0.00; Plate: 7 row: P column: 16; Seq primer: SK.
Note: Vector: pBluescript SK+; Site_1: EcoRI (5'-end of cDNA); Site_2: XhoI (3'-end of cDNA); Approximately 5 % of the clones correspond to cDNA from the fungi B. graminis hordei and tritici, respectively. Due to a cloning artefact caused by the kit, in most cases the EcoRI site is NOT present, as well as the EcoRIadapter used for cloning. To excise the insert, restriction sites upstream EcoRI should be used (e.g. BamHI, SalI,PstI). NOTE: Also due to the cloning system used Blue/white selection for recombinats is not 100% reliable. Average insert size is 1.2 kb
